Not all of that 40Gb is Vista, i'd guess about 10Gb is the actual OS.
Some common maintenance tools that I find handy are as follows...
1) Cleanup! - http://stevengould.o.../CleanUp452.exe
2) CCleaner - http://www.filehippo...nload_ccleaner/
3) Auslogics Disk Defrag - http://download.cnet...4-10567503.html
4) Removing unwanted or used programs
5) Using Disk Cleanup to free some space - Start > All Programs > Accessories > System Tools > Disk Cleanup
* It might be worth noting the more options tab under the Disk Cleanup utility.
